
Параметр access определяет уровень доступа к функциям, данным или интерфейсу программы. Его значение часто задаётся автоматически при установке или обновлении системы, что может привести к ненужным ограничениям или конфликтам с другими настройками. В некоторых случаях параметр требуется удалить, чтобы восстановить гибкость управления доступом или устранить ошибку авторизации.
Перед изменением конфигурации необходимо определить, где хранится значение access – в пользовательском интерфейсе, системном реестре или конфигурационном файле. Этот шаг позволяет избежать случайного удаления других параметров и сохранить работоспособность программы. Также важно убедиться, что у пользователя есть права на изменение настроек или доступ к файлам конфигурации.
Удаление значения параметра access может выполняться разными способами: через графический интерфейс, с помощью командной строки или прямого редактирования конфигурации. Выбор метода зависит от типа системы и уровня привилегий. После удаления стоит проверить результат и убедиться, что система корректно применяет обновлённые параметры.
Проверка текущего значения параметра access

Перед удалением параметра access необходимо точно определить, где и в каком виде он задан. В большинстве случаев значение хранится в конфигурационном файле, реестре или настройках панели управления. Если используется программное обеспечение с графическим интерфейсом, откройте раздел Права доступа или Security Settings и найдите строку с параметром access.
В системах на базе Linux параметр часто указывается в файлах с расширением .conf. Для проверки используйте команду grep «access» /etc/* -R – она выведет все упоминания параметра по пути к файлам конфигурации. На Windows можно воспользоваться командой reg query для поиска значения в реестре, указав путь к разделу настроек конкретной программы.
Если конфигурация хранится в базе данных или внутреннем файле приложения, стоит использовать встроенные инструменты диагностики или логирования. После нахождения параметра access нужно записать его текущее значение, чтобы при необходимости вернуть исходное состояние. Это упрощает последующую проверку корректности работы системы после удаления параметра.
Определение уровня доступа, заданного по умолчанию
После проверки текущего значения параметра access важно определить, какой уровень доступа используется системой по умолчанию. Это помогает понять, какое поведение будет применено после удаления параметра и не приведёт ли изменение к блокировке функций или пользователей.
Большинство систем имеют предустановленные уровни доступа, где значение access определяет степень разрешений. Ниже приведена таблица с типичными значениями и их назначением:
| Значение параметра | Описание |
|---|---|
| 0 | Доступ полностью запрещён, используется для изоляции компонентов или пользователей без прав. |
| 1 | Минимальный уровень – разрешено чтение, но не запись или выполнение команд. |
| 2 | Расширенный доступ – разрешены операции чтения и записи, но без административных прав. |
| 3 | Полный доступ, включая изменение системных параметров и запуск привилегированных процессов. |
Изменение значения access через интерфейс настроек

Если программа поддерживает изменение параметра access через графический интерфейс, это можно сделать без редактирования конфигурационных файлов. Такой способ безопаснее, так как система автоматически проверяет корректность введённых данных.
Для изменения значения выполните последовательность действий:
- Откройте панель настроек или раздел Параметры доступа.
- Найдите пункт, содержащий параметр access – он может располагаться в категории Безопасность или Пользователи и разрешения.
- Выберите текущее значение и нажмите кнопку Изменить или Редактировать.
- Удалите содержимое поля либо установите значение, соответствующее минимальному уровню доступа.
- Сохраните изменения и перезапустите приложение, чтобы новые настройки вступили в силу.
Если интерфейс не отображает параметр access явно, включите режим расширенных параметров или административный доступ. Некоторые программы скрывают чувствительные настройки до активации опции Показать системные параметры.
После изменения рекомендуется проверить результат. Для этого откройте раздел состояния или используйте встроенную функцию Проверить права. Если значение параметра не отображается, это означает, что оно сброшено или удалено корректно.
Удаление параметра access в конфигурационном файле
Если параметр access задан напрямую в конфигурационном файле, его можно удалить вручную. Этот способ подходит для систем и приложений, где настройки не защищены интерфейсом и редактируются текстовым методом. Перед изменениями рекомендуется создать резервную копию файла, чтобы при необходимости восстановить исходное состояние.
Для удаления параметра выполните следующие шаги:
1. Найдите файл конфигурации. Его расположение можно определить по документации программы или через консоль, выполнив команду find /etc -name «*.conf» в Linux или поиск по имени файла в Windows.
2. Откройте файл в текстовом редакторе с правами администратора, например nano, vim или Notepad++.
3. Найдите строку, содержащую параметр access. Она может выглядеть как access=2 или access «full».
4. Удалите строку полностью либо закомментируйте её, добавив символ # в начале строки.
5. Сохраните изменения и перезапустите службу или приложение для применения новых настроек.
После перезапуска проверьте, что параметр не был автоматически восстановлен. Для этого снова откройте файл и убедитесь в отсутствии строки access. Если система перезаписывает конфигурацию, следует отключить функцию автогенерации настроек или внести изменения в основной шаблон конфигурации.
Сброс параметра access с помощью командной строки
Сброс параметра access через командную строку позволяет быстро удалить или изменить его значение без открытия интерфейса или редактирования файлов вручную. Этот способ особенно полезен для серверных систем и автоматизированных сценариев настройки.
В Linux можно использовать команду sed для удаления строки с параметром из конфигурационного файла. Пример:
sudo sed -i ‘/^access/d’ /etc/app/config.conf
Команда удаляет все строки, начинающиеся с слова access, не изменяя другие параметры. Если нужно только очистить значение, а не удалить строку, используйте:
sudo sed -i ‘s/^access=.*/access=/’ /etc/app/config.conf
В Windows сброс выполняется через PowerShell. Команда:
(Get-Content «C:\ProgramData\App\config.ini») | Where-Object {$_ -notmatch «^access»} | Set-Content «C:\ProgramData\App\config.ini»
Этот пример исключает строки с параметром access и сохраняет изменённый файл без перезапуска системы.
Если параметр хранится в реестре Windows, можно использовать утилиту reg delete:
reg delete «HKLM\Software\AppName» /v access /f
После выполнения команд рекомендуется проверить изменения с помощью grep или reg query. При автоматизации процессов стоит добавить проверку выхода команды, чтобы убедиться в успешном удалении параметра.
Проверка результата после удаления значения

После удаления параметра access необходимо убедиться, что система корректно применяет новые настройки и не восстановила удалённое значение автоматически. Проверка должна выполняться сразу после перезапуска программы или службы.
Для подтверждения результата выполните следующие действия:
- Откройте файл конфигурации и убедитесь в отсутствии строки, содержащей access.
- В Windows выполните поиск по файлу конфигурации или в реестре через команду reg query и проверьте, что параметр не отображается.
- Запустите приложение и откройте раздел настроек, где ранее отображался параметр access. Он должен быть пуст или недоступен для изменения.
Если после проверки параметр появился снова, вероятно, используется механизм автоконфигурации. В этом случае следует отключить автоматическую синхронизацию настроек или внести правки в шаблон конфигурации, из которого система восстанавливает значения.
Для окончательной проверки можно создать журнал изменений. В нём фиксируются даты редактирования файлов и команд, применённых к конфигурации. Сравнение временных меток позволит определить, не было ли автоматического восстановления параметра после удаления.
Предотвращение повторного появления параметра access

После удаления параметра access система может автоматически восстановить его при обновлении или синхронизации настроек. Чтобы исключить повторное появление, необходимо заблокировать механизмы, отвечающие за автогенерацию конфигурации, и ограничить права записи для файлов, где ранее находился параметр.
В Linux можно применить команду chattr +i /etc/app/config.conf, чтобы сделать файл неизменяемым. Это предотвратит автоматическую запись новых значений, включая параметр access. Для отмены защиты используется команда chattr -i.
В Windows рекомендуется задать разрешения на уровне файловой системы. Откройте свойства конфигурационного файла, перейдите в раздел Безопасность и снимите флажок Разрешить запись для всех пользователей, кроме администратора. Это исключит перезапись параметра при автозапуске приложения.
Если значение access добавляется при запуске через шаблон или скрипт, следует отредактировать исходный файл шаблона. Найдите строку с параметром и удалите её либо закомментируйте символом #. Затем пересоздайте конфигурацию вручную без упоминания access.
Для контроля изменений стоит внедрить систему мониторинга. Используйте inotifywait в Linux или журнал событий Windows для отслеживания модификаций конфигурационных файлов. Это позволит своевременно определить, если параметр access будет восстановлен системой или сторонним процессом.
Вопрос-ответ:
Почему после удаления параметра access он снова появляется в конфигурационном файле?
Часто значение восстанавливается автоматически системой или службой, которая при запуске создаёт конфигурацию заново. Чтобы этого избежать, нужно отключить механизм автогенерации или сделать файл неизменяемым через команду chattr +i в Linux. В Windows можно снять права на запись для всех пользователей, кроме администратора.
Можно ли удалить параметр access без прав администратора?
Если у пользователя нет административных прав, удалить параметр не получится — система заблокирует попытку записи. В таких случаях стоит запросить временные права через администратора системы или воспользоваться пользовательским файлом настроек, если программа поддерживает локальные конфигурации.
Как узнать, где именно хранится параметр access, если его нет в интерфейсе?
Некоторые программы не отображают все параметры в настройках. Попробуйте выполнить поиск по файлам с помощью команды grep «access» /etc/* -R в Linux или воспользуйтесь функцией поиска по содержимому в Windows. Также стоит проверить папки AppData или ProgramData, где часто сохраняются вспомогательные файлы конфигурации.
Что делать, если после удаления параметра программа перестала запускаться?
Это может означать, что система требует наличие параметра, даже если его значение не используется напрямую. В такой ситуации нужно вернуть параметр с нейтральным значением, например access=0, и перезапустить программу. После этого можно изучить документацию, чтобы определить допустимые варианты изменения.
Как проверить, что параметр access действительно удалён и не влияет на работу?
Проверьте файл конфигурации с помощью grep или findstr и убедитесь в отсутствии строк с упоминанием access. Затем перезапустите приложение и выполните тест действий, связанных с доступом, например открытие разделов, требующих авторизации. Если функции работают корректно и параметр не появился снова, изменение применено успешно.
Можно ли удалить параметр access через терминал без редактирования файлов вручную?
Да, это возможно. В Linux используется команда sed -i ‘/^access/d’ /etc/app/config.conf, которая удаляет все строки с параметром access из указанного файла. В Windows аналогичное действие выполняется через PowerShell командой (Get-Content «C:\ProgramData\App\config.ini») | Where-Object {$_ -notmatch «^access»} | Set-Content «C:\ProgramData\App\config.ini». Эти способы позволяют изменить настройки без открытия конфигурационного файла вручную.
Почему после удаления параметра access программа теряет часть функционала?
Некоторые приложения используют параметр access для контроля разрешений на выполнение команд или работу с отдельными модулями. После его удаления система может переходить в безопасный режим, блокируя действия, требующие проверки прав. Чтобы избежать этого, можно задать параметр с нейтральным значением, например access=default, или указать допустимый уровень доступа через интерфейс программы, не полностью удаляя строку из конфигурации.
